Arsenal are set to face Fulham on Saturday evening, with the chance to widen their lead at the top of the Premier League .
With second-placed Liverpool playing Manchester United on Sunday afternoon, the Gunners have the opportunity to pile pressure on the reigning champions with a win at Craven Cottage. Mikel Arteta will be eagerly welcoming back his international stars following a successful October break.
